Get Temporary U.S. Employment with Work Visa Lawyers in 53051, Menomonee Falls

Work visas grant you the ability to work in the United States for a specified period of time. The H-1B visa is a widely used option for non-citizen professionals seeking employment in the U.S. There are a limited number of H-1B visas granted every year, which means it's an especially smart move to hire a work visa attorney in Menomonee Falls, WI.

The H-1B isn't the only work visa offered. The TN (NAFTA) visa is available for Mexican and Canadian Citizens. Among your other visa options are L-1 visas for intercompany transfers, E visas for investors and traders and their employees, a range of J-1 visas for trainees, and O-1 visas for people with exceptional abilities. 53051Immigration Lawyers for Employer-Sponsored Green Cards

A green card means you have permanent U.S. residency, which affords the right to live and work here indefinitely. Just like an employer can sponsor a visa, they can also sponsor a green card. The process generally starts with a permanent labor certification, or PERM. This certification protects the U.S. labor market while allowing businesses to hire skilled international workers permanently. The PERM process has tight regulations and can be time-consuming to navigate. So, you will want the peace of mind offered by hiring an immigration attorney in Menomonee Falls, WI.

With the National Interest Waiver (NIW) green card, some foreign nationals are able to waive employer sponsorship and the PERM. An NIW is meant for people whose employment would be a benefit to the U.S. These individuals often hold advanced degrees or have exceptional ability. It provides them with the option to sponsor themselves for an employment-based green card. U.S. Immigration Lawyers in 53051, Menomonee Falls for Family Green Cards and Visas

You may qualify to file for a visa or green card to reunite with your spouse, fiancée, or other family member in the U.S. If you need to grant your foreign-born children, spouse, or fiancée temporary entrance to the U.S., a K-1 and K-3 visa might help. The Fiancé(e) Visa (also known as a K-1 visa) is meant for individuals getting married to an American citizen within 90 days of arrival. For spouses of U.S. citizens, the K-3 visa grants entrance to the county while their immigrant visa petition is processed. If you plan to apply for a Green Card for Family Preference Immigrants, let Weinstock Immigration Lawyers guide you through the process. This green card process provides a pathway for family members of U.S. citizens and lawful permanent residents (LPRs) to secure permanent residency in the United States. These family members include parents, siblings, children, and spouses. Congress sets a yearly limit on the issuance of family-based visas, and the multi-step process can be grueling. According to USAFacts.com, "The median processing time for family-based immigration applications — for spouses, dependent children, and parents of U.S. citizens — rose from 4.7 months to 11.8 months between 2013 and 2023."
